1
Corinthians 11:1
Be imitators of me, just as I also am of Christ.
In Paul's letters to the Corinthians, he exhorted them to pattern their lives after Jesus Christ. Paul understood that obedience to a creed simply takes us to a proper and higher level of lifestyle. Accepting Jesus Christ as Our Savior and patterning our lives after Him will move us toward a level of perfection, holiness and purity that only He could attain and we can begin to approach through Him.
In truth, it is not good enough to be good. It is not good enough to do great works. The only thing that we can do that is of any eternal value is to submit our lives to Jesus Christ as Our Savior, to die of self and to take on the spirit of the One who dwells within us. Anything less than full submission to Our Lord and Master and anything less than becoming imitators of Jesus Christ as His disciples leaves us short of being true Christians.
